WHALEN, GREYHOUNDS RANKED IN NCAA BASKETBALL STATS

BETHLEHEM, PA --- Senior guard Rich Whalen (East Brunswick, NJ/East Brunswick HS) of the Moravian College men’s basketball team is ranked in the latest NCAA Division III national statistics released Thursday.

Whalen entered play this week ranked eighth in the nation at 3.5 steals per game. The Greyhounds as a team entered the week ranked 10th nationally in free throw percentage at .748 percent. Whalen leads Moravian and the MAC Commonwealth Conference with a free throw percentage of .879 percent.

Moravian currently has a 10-13 overall record and a 6-7 record in the MAC Commonwealth Conference after winning its last two games. The Greyhounds complete the 1999-2000 regular season on Saturday, February 19th at Messiah College in a 4:00 p.m. If Moravian wins the game, and Susquehanna University losses to Albright College Saturday night, the Greyhounds will qualify for the Middle Atlantic Conference playoffs for the first time since the 1996-97 season.
